Manchester City have successfully overturned their two-year ban from European club competitions. The Court of Arbitration for Sport announced the club were cleared of “disguising equity funds as sponsorship contributions”. Sir Alex Ferguson the manager of Manchester United is set to retire at the end of the season after 26 years in charge. The Scot who is 71 has won 38 trophies for the club and will now become a director and ambassador. His haul includes 13 league titles, two Champions League crowns, five FA […]
